Don't underline text that isn't a link
use real headings : h1 for "Welcome to O'Connell Extreme Fitness on the Internet!" and h2s for the other 2 headings.
make the logo a link to home too.
the o'connel text in the logo is hard to read - but i guess you didn't make their logo?
avoid using 'click here' as link text
e.g. where you have
"to learn more about this life changing program, click here."
use something like
"learn more about this life changing program"
the text is way small! i know you seem to be targeting young healthy people with presumably good eyesight but it could easily be a couple of px bigger and with a little more line height too to invite people into the text rather than it feeling small and closed
